Part 2  WCA Baselines

[Note to Bidders: Ideally, from the Authority's perspective, the Contractor will take composition risk.  If, however, Bidders propose for evaluation some sharing of composition risk, this ought to be limited to the extent to which the Authority and its constituent WCAs are able to manage that risk and accordingly it ought to be limited to changes in their activity. If that route is adopted a WCA Baseline will be required against which to measure changes in WCA activity. The baseline (WCA Baselines) should set out the commodities collected and methods of collection without reference to the product of that activity (eg no tonnages are expected to be given).

A WCA Baseline will therefore be a table setting out:

 Commodities (but not tonnages) of waste collected for recycling by the WCAs;

 Receptacles;

 Frequencies of collection;

 Area of the WCA at which the scheme applies;

 (If relevant) whether and the extent to which Commercial ("trade") Waste is collected.

The table may project future roll out plans to tie in with the Authority's adopted JMWMS. The extent to which the WDA plans to work with the WCAs to agree review procedures or a sharing of risk is a matter for the WDA and WCAs and any inter authority agreement and ought not to be of concern of Bidders.

For Authorities, this information ought to be made available to Bidders at ISDS and it is not envisaged that it is an onerous requirement given that such data is available and will have been recorded in Authorities' OBC]
